Output 3cc76ccadcd25a3d163cf8b4258120ba01664b17c4d12293f2f35dee3fad8e45:12

value
19998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2cb7afc34ca2e50b25794db9e59d6d1cd804c6 OP_EQUAL
address
3P3DcTeTH9NWFZovQWaPMgAhkKy4mVD7iW
transaction
3cc76ccadcd25a3d163cf8b4258120ba01664b17c4d12293f2f35dee3fad8e45
confirmations
341792
spent
true